Fault code L 0- appears across 1 boiler brand and 1 models. The exact meaning varies by manufacturer — pick your boiler brand below to see the model-specific fix.

Most common meaning Your boiler has locked itself out because it has been manually reset too many times in a short period while trying to clear an underlying fault. (As reported on Ideal Logic Max Combi 2)
